What Policies Should My Business Carry?
In Florida, most businesses are required to have workers’ compensation insurance. This can cover your employees’ medical expenses and lost wages if they get sick or injured due to an on-the-job incident. The employers’ liability component within workers’ compensation coverage. It can also cover your legal expenses if you are sued for on-the-job injuries.
What are Recommended Policies for My Business?
Depending on your business’s own circumstances, your agent may recommend that you purchase the following:
- Commercial property insurance may cover the repair or replacement costs of furniture, equipment, tools and inventory. It can also cover damages to your office or storefront.
- Commercial auto insurance may cover damages to business-owned vehicles caused by fires, theft, accidents, vandalism or certain weather events.
- General liability insurance may be beneficial if a client files a claim of property damage, bodily injury or advertising injury against your business.
- Professional liability insurance may cover claims of negligence, missed deadlines or errors.
- Cyber insurance may cover damages caused by data leaks or cyberattacks.
How Much Do These Policies Cost?
The cost of business insurance policies may depend on the following factors:
- Industry
- Number of employees
- Location
- Prior claims
- Policy specifics (e.g., deductibles, coverage limits)
